Spontaneous dissociation of 85Rb Feshbach molecules

Phys Rev Lett. 2005 Jan 21;94(2):020401. doi: 10.1103/PhysRevLett.94.020401. Epub 2005 Jan 18.

Abstract

The spontaneous dissociation of 85Rb dimers in the highest lying vibrational level has been observed in the vicinity of the Feshbach resonance that was used to produce them. The molecular lifetime shows a strong dependence on magnetic field, varying by 3 orders of magnitude between 155.5 G and 162.2 G. Our measurements are in good agreement with theoretical predictions in which molecular dissociation is driven by inelastic spin relaxation. Molecule lifetimes of tens of milliseconds can be achieved within approximately a 1 G wide region directly above the Feshbach resonance.
